<feed xmlns='http://www.w3.org/2005/Atom'>
<title>user/richard/torbutton, branch bug_29825_v2</title>
<subtitle>Richard's torbutton repository</subtitle>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/'/>
<entry>
<title>Bug 29825: Intelligently add the new Security Level button to the taskbar</title>
<updated>2019-03-29T20:25:50+00:00</updated>
<author>
<name>Richard Pospesel</name>
<email>richard@torproject.org</email>
</author>
<published>2019-03-29T20:00:00+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=9cd11824581391d1307d517b3cfb4b18b0c3056f'/>
<id>9cd11824581391d1307d517b3cfb4b18b0c3056f</id>
<content type='text'>
Added logic to torbutton to add the Security Level button after the
url bar, and subsequently move Tor Button between. This new method keeps
any UI customizations the user has made. In the event of error, the UI
configuration reverts back to the default as specified in the
browser.uiCustomization.state pref.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Added logic to torbutton to add the Security Level button after the
url bar, and subsequently move Tor Button between. This new method keeps
any UI customizations the user has made. In the event of error, the UI
configuration reverts back to the default as specified in the
browser.uiCustomization.state pref.
</pre>
</div>
</content>
</entry>
<entry>
<title>Translations update</title>
<updated>2019-03-17T09:27:25+00:00</updated>
<author>
<name>Georg Koppen</name>
<email>gk@torproject.org</email>
</author>
<published>2019-03-17T09:27:25+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=7fa720a7c73b427f05e35100ccd5bb50f404279d'/>
<id>7fa720a7c73b427f05e35100ccd5bb50f404279d</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Correcting branch name for securitylevel.properties</title>
<updated>2019-03-17T09:24:49+00:00</updated>
<author>
<name>Georg Koppen</name>
<email>gk@torproject.org</email>
</author>
<published>2019-03-17T09:24:49+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=33d5b58a507ae529af073ef3448d6f5ab36fa8a7'/>
<id>33d5b58a507ae529af073ef3448d6f5ab36fa8a7</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Translations update</title>
<updated>2019-03-17T09:20:16+00:00</updated>
<author>
<name>Georg Koppen</name>
<email>gk@torproject.org</email>
</author>
<published>2019-03-17T09:20:16+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=a890699d47e08a640af4d56bb16533c96f7f2f8d'/>
<id>a890699d47e08a640af4d56bb16533c96f7f2f8d</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Release preparations for 2.1.5</title>
<updated>2019-03-15T16:18:40+00:00</updated>
<author>
<name>Georg Koppen</name>
<email>gk@torproject.org</email>
</author>
<published>2019-03-15T16:18:40+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=498d64784659082877bc83ecca24fbf8d137125f'/>
<id>498d64784659082877bc83ecca24fbf8d137125f</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Translations update</title>
<updated>2019-03-15T16:06:24+00:00</updated>
<author>
<name>Georg Koppen</name>
<email>gk@torproject.org</email>
</author>
<published>2019-03-15T16:06:24+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=465550f62331dea670debab50322521dac5fe460'/>
<id>465550f62331dea670debab50322521dac5fe460</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>Bug 28628: Change onboarding Security panel to open new Security Level panel.</title>
<updated>2019-03-15T07:12:00+00:00</updated>
<author>
<name>Kathy Brade</name>
<email>brade@pearlcrescent.com</email>
</author>
<published>2019-03-12T20:53:45+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=52c12d905ff4f6d35d5788b5cc379e474be429e9'/>
<id>52c12d905ff4f6d35d5788b5cc379e474be429e9</id>
<content type='text'>
Add new string: label for the "action" button within the onboarding
Security panel.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Add new string: label for the "action" button within the onboarding
Security panel.
</pre>
</div>
</content>
</entry>
<entry>
<title>Bug 25658: Replace security slider with security level UI</title>
<updated>2019-03-15T06:52:46+00:00</updated>
<author>
<name>Richard Pospesel</name>
<email>richard@torproject.org</email>
</author>
<published>2019-03-14T20:55:28+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=5a3d6d26e1f8046b20e51d93ca9457a729063bfc'/>
<id>5a3d6d26e1f8046b20e51d93ca9457a729063bfc</id>
<content type='text'>
This patch has security level related changes for torbutton.
Migrated 'security level' related strings from torbutton.dtd to new
securityLevel.properties file, loaded by JS in the new securitylevel
component in Tor Browser. Removed the old Security Slider xul and menu
entry in the torbutton menu. Also 'fixed' the german (de) torbutton.dtd
file (was valid listing of XML entities, but it broke my dtd parser used
to migrate strings)

Added new "extensions.torbutton.inserted_security_level" pref to
torbutton that piggy backs off the existing
"extensions.torbutton.inserted_button" pref logic. Toolbars are reset to
the Tor Browser default when the new 'inserted_security_level' pref is
false. Coupled with the changes in tor-browser, users which upgrade will
have their toolbars reset to the new design.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ch has security level related changes for torbutton.
Migrated 'security level' related strings from torbutton.dtd to new
securityLevel.properties file, loaded by JS in the new securitylevel
component in Tor Browser. Removed the old Security Slider xul and menu
entry in the torbutton menu. Also 'fixed' the german (de) torbutton.dtd
file (was valid listing of XML entities, but it broke my dtd parser used
to migrate strings)

Added new "extensions.torbutton.inserted_security_level" pref to
torbutton that piggy backs off the existing
"extensions.torbutton.inserted_button" pref logic. Toolbars are reset to
the Tor Browser default when the new 'inserted_security_level' pref is
false. Coupled with the changes in tor-browser, users which upgrade will
have their toolbars reset to the new design.
</pre>
</div>
</content>
</entry>
<entry>
<title>Bug 27478: Torbutton in Tor Browser 8 difficult to see in dark theme</title>
<updated>2019-03-14T21:26:39+00:00</updated>
<author>
<name>Richard Pospesel</name>
<email>richard@torproject.org</email>
</author>
<published>2019-03-14T21:26:39+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=2930d898032e04443527af8c6528481f202a2c4e'/>
<id>2930d898032e04443527af8c6528481f202a2c4e</id>
<content type='text'>
Changed the torbutton icon svgs to use 'context-fill' for fill and
'context-opacity' for opacity attributes. With this change firefox
will provide the correct color values to our icons so they always look
correct for with the current theme.
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Changed the torbutton icon svgs to use 'context-fill' for fill and
'context-opacity' for opacity attributes. With this change firefox
will provide the correct color values to our icons so they always look
correct for with the current theme.
</pre>
</div>
</content>
</entry>
<entry>
<title>Bug 29440: Update about:tor when Tor Browser is updated</title>
<updated>2019-03-13T14:43:04+00:00</updated>
<author>
<name>Kathy Brade</name>
<email>brade@pearlcrescent.com</email>
</author>
<published>2019-03-11T15:28:20+00:00</published>
<link rel='alternate' type='text/html' href='https://gitweb.torproject.org/user/richard/torbutton.git/commit/?id=82a5f8665a6b5a7f5d4c78f0a526dfa16834ec7f'/>
<id>82a5f8665a6b5a7f5d4c78f0a526dfa16834ec7f</id>
<content type='text'>
After the browser has been updated, notify the user by displaying
a message on the about:tor page. Also, in release and alpha builds,
include on the about:tor page below the Tor Browser version a link
to a simplified changelog page (which continues to be located at
about:tbupdate).
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
After the browser has been updated, notify the user by displaying
a message on the about:tor page. Also, in release and alpha builds,
include on the about:tor page below the Tor Browser version a link
to a simplified changelog page (which continues to be located at
about:tbupdate).
</pre>
</div>
</content>
</entry>
</feed>
